A political science artifact is an object or document that holds historical or scholarly significance within the field of political science. It could be anything from a political campaign poster to a constitutional document that provides insight into a country's political system and processes. These artifacts are often used by researchers and scholars to study political phenomena and events.

How is political science both an art and science?

Political science is considered both an art and a science because it combines empirical research methods and data analysis (science) with interpretation, analysis, and judgment of political behavior and institutions (art). It involves the systematic study of political systems, government policies, and political processes using both quantitative and qualitative methodologies.


Political science is science or not. Information about it?

Political science is considered a social science because it studies human behavior, institutions, and systems related to politics and governance. It uses scientific methods to analyze and understand political phenomena and develop theories to explain political behavior and decision-making. While it may not adhere to the scientific method in the same way as natural sciences, political science aims to provide systematic and evidence-based insights into political processes and structures.

What is the functions of political science?

Political science seeks to understand political systems, institutions, and behavior. It analyzes the distribution of power, the formulation of policies, and the impact of government actions on society. Political science ultimately aims to inform decision-making processes and contribute to the improvement of governance and public policy.
